Answer:
The IQR of the data set is 4.5
Step-by-step explanation:
Given:
10 13 15 12 12 4 12 17
12 13 15 18 10 11 20 19
Now, to determine the IQR (interquartile range) of this data set.
So, <em>we need to set the data in numerical orders:</em>
4 10 10 11 12 12 12 12
13 13 15 15 17 18 19 20
Now,<em> we split this in half and get the medians of both half:</em>
<u>4 10 10 11 12 12 12 12 </u> Median 1 = 11.5
<u>13 13 15 15 17 18 19 20 </u> Median 2 = 16
Getting the medians of both half now we subtract the median 1 from median 2:
IQR = 16 - 11.5
IQR = 4.5.
Therefore, the IQR of the data set is 4.5
